MESSRS. ROZA BROS.
Hong Kong. 302 20 Silver prices rose 1/16 yesterday for both deliveries, the quotations being 20 1/2 for Ready and 20 7/15 for. Forward. Silver advices re- ported India as having bought. China sold. Buyers were satis- Hed. After the official' fixing bust- ness was done at 1/10 under the quoted rate, due to offerings by China. American Sliver was quot- ed at 44 3/4 for Spot.
The London-New York cross- rate was quoted at 4.89 3/4 New York-London was unchanged at 4.89 31/32.

TEXTILE EXPORTS
Sir Henry Gullett, Australian Minister for Trade Treaties, has is- sued a statement in reply to the criticism by the Manchester Cham. ber of Commerce of the new com- mercial agreement between Aus- tralia and Japan.
